U.S. intelligence officials say that the evidence indicates that Hamas terrorists were responsible for an explosion outside a Gaza hospital.
The New York Times reported that sources inside the intelligence community have “satellite and other infrared data showing a launch of a rocket or missile from Palestinian fighter positions within Gaza.”
“While we continue to collect information, our current assessment, based on analysis of overhead imagery, intercepts and open-source information, is that Israel is not responsible for the explosion at the hospital in Gaza yesterday,” said Adrienne Watson, a spokeswoman for the National Security Council.
President Joe Biden responded to the news that Hamas terrorists mistakenly bombed a hospital in the Gaza Strip with a misfired rocket by saying they should “learn how to shoot straight.”
“I’m not suggesting that Hamas deliberately did it,” the President told reporters at Ramstein Air Base in Germany en route back to Washington after visiting Israel earlier on Wednesday.
“It’s that old thing: Gotta learn how to shoot straight,” Biden went on. “It’s not the first time that Hamas has launched something that didn’t function very well.”

On October 7th, Hamas sent thousands of missiles and hundreds of gunmen across the border, targeting civilian homes and a music festival.
Documents show that Hamas created detailed plans to target elementary schools and a youth center in the Israeli kibbutz of Kfar Sa’ad, to “kill as many people as possible,” according to NBC News.
The plans contradict Hamas head of international relations Dr. Basem Naim’s claim that they didn’t intentionally target civilians.
“The chief commander of the Al Qassem Brigade, who initiated the operation, he gave clear instructions not to target civilians or not to harm civilians,” he told ABC’s 7.30.
“In the middle of the confrontation, there was some civilians. The clear instruction was not to kill civilians.”
The Hamas leader added that there were no plans to take civilian hostages.
“We haven’t planned at any moment to take any civilian hostages. The plan was to take on the fight against soldiers and to take some soldiers as hostages.”
The number of Americans slain has reached 32 in Israel and 11 remain unaccounted for. Two U.S. citizens being held inside Gaza were released on Friday after being kidnapped last weekend by Hamas.
“In response to Qatari efforts, Al-Qassam Brigades released two American citizens (a mother and her daughter),” terrorists said in a statement.
